Numerical and experimental research of two-phase flow in the nozzle with high concentration of a disperse phase

The outcomes numerical and experimental research of two-phase flow in the nozzle for want of high concentration of a disperse phase are represented. The comparison of gasdynamic parameters of flow in the nozzle for different significances of concentration is conducted. The influence of an initial angle of a vector of a velocity to distribution of parameters on a tract of the nozzle (transversal structures of parameters) is shown. The reliability of numerical researches is confirmed by a comparison with experimental data.
